简介:在JavaScript中,您可以使用Fetch API或XMLHttpRequest来从服务器获取JSON文件的内容。以下是一个简单的示例,展示如何使用Fetch API来实现这一目标。
要使用JavaScript获取JSON文件的内容,您需要先从服务器获取该文件。Fetch API是一个用于获取网络资源的强大工具,它返回一个Promise对象,使异步操作变得更加简单。以下是使用Fetch API获取JSON文件内容的步骤:
let url = 'https://example.com/data.json';
在上面的代码中,我们首先使用Fetch API发送一个GET请求到指定的URL。然后,我们使用
fetch(url).then(response => response.json()).then(data => console.log(data)).catch((error) => console.error('Error:', error));
.then()方法处理响应,将响应转换为JSON格式。接下来,我们再次使用.then()方法处理解析后的JSON数据,并将其打印到控制台。如果发生错误,我们使用.catch()方法捕获错误并将其打印到控制台。require()函数代替Fetch API来获取JSON文件的内容。例如:在上述Node.js代码中,我们使用
let url = 'https://example.com/data.json';let request = require('request');request(url, function (error, response, body) {if (!error && response.statusCode == 200) {let data = JSON.parse(body);console.log(data);}});
request模块发送GET请求到指定的URL。然后,我们检查是否发生错误以及响应的状态码是否为200(表示成功)。如果一切正常,我们将响应主体解析为JSON格式,并将其打印到控制台。request模块,都可以轻松地获取JSON文件的内容。请根据您的项目需求和环境选择最适合您的解决方案。